Beyond identifying promising assets, the timing of your entry is crucial. This is where concepts like dollar-cost averaging (DCA) shine. Instead of attempting to time the market perfectly – a notoriously difficult feat – DCA involves investing a fixed amount of money at regular intervals, regardless of the asset's price. This strategy mitigates the risk of buying at a market peak and averages out your purchase price over time. It’s a patient approach, designed to build a position gradually and capitalize on market fluctuations without the emotional turmoil of trying to predict every up and down. It’s the steady drip that fills the bucket, rather than the hoping for a sudden deluge.

The world of crypto also offers exciting avenues for generating passive income, moving beyond simple buy-and-hold strategies. Staking is one of the most popular methods. Many proof-of-stake (PoS) cryptocurrencies allow you to "stake" your holdings, essentially locking them up to support the network's operations and, in return, earning rewards. This is akin to earning interest on a savings account, but with the potential for significantly higher yields. The amount of rewards often depends on the cryptocurrency, the network's demand, and the duration you stake. Platforms like Coinbase, Binance, and Kraken offer staking services, or you can stake directly through certain wallets for greater control.
Another powerful passive income strategy is yield farming within the DeFi ecosystem. This involves provid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ges (DEXs) or lending protocols. In return for supplying your crypto assets, you earn transaction fees and/or interest from borrowers. Yield farming can offer attractive returns, but it also comes with higher risks, including impermanent loss (where the value of your staked assets decreases compared to simply holding them) and smart contract vulnerabilities. Understanding the mechanics of specific DeFi protocols and carefully managing your risk exposure are non-negotiable for anyone venturing into this space. Navigating the crypto market also means understanding and preparing for its inherent volatility. This is where risk management strategies come into play, and they are not an afterthought but an integral part of any successful crypto wealth strategy. Setting clear profit targets and stop-loss orders can help protect your capital. A stop-loss order automatically sells an asset when it reaches a predetermined price, limiting potential losses. Conversely, profit targets can help you lock in gains before a market reversal. These tools, when used judiciously, can prevent emotional decision-making during periods of market stress. One of the most revolutionary advancements in this space is Decentralized Finance (DeFi). DeFi aims to recreate traditional financial services – lending, borrowing, trading, insurance – without the need for intermediaries like banks. This disintermediation offers greater transparency, accessibility, and potentially higher returns. For wealth creation, engaging with DeFi protocols can be incredibly rewarding. Decentralized exchanges (DEXs), such as Uniswap and SushiSwap, allow users to trade cryptocurrencies directly from their wallets, often with lower fees and greater privacy than centralized exchanges. Lending and borrowing protocols, like Aave and Compound, enable users to earn interest on their crypto by lending it out or to borrow assets by providing collateral. These platforms often offer yields that far surpass traditional finance, making them a key component of a proactive crypto wealth strategy.
However, the allure of DeFi also necessitates a heightened awareness of its risks. Smart contract risk is a significant concern; bugs or vulnerabilities in the code of a DeFi protocol can lead to the loss of user funds. Impermanent loss is another factor to consider, particularly for liquidity providers on DEXs. This occurs when the price of the deposited assets diverges from the price they would have had if simply held in a wallet. Understanding the specific mechanics of each protocol, the audited status of its smart contracts, and the potential for impermanent loss is paramount before committing capital. The concept of crypto-backed loans is another innovative strategy that allows individuals to leverage their digital assets without selling them. Many platforms now allow users to borrow stablecoins or fiat currency by using their cryptocurrency holdings as collateral. This can be particularly useful for accessing liquidity for other investments or for managing cash flow without triggering taxable events that selling crypto might entail. The loan-to-value (LTV) ratio, interest rates, and the risk of liquidation if the collateral value drops significantly are critical factors to evaluate when considering this strategy.

The notion of "crypto arbitrage" presents a more quantitative approach to wealth generation. This strategy involves exploiting price discrepancies of the same cryptocurrency across different exchanges. For example, if Bitcoin is trading at $30,000 on Exchange A and $30,100 on Exchange B, an arbitrageur can simultaneously buy on A and sell on B to capture the $100 difference. This requires sophisticated trading tools, rapid execution, and access to multiple exchanges, as price differences are often fleeting and quickly corrected by market forces. While it can offer consistent, albeit smaller, returns, it’s a strategy best suited for experienced traders with automated systems.
